Petria Mitchell uses nature as an initial reference point in her paintings. “This allows me to play with limitless visual possibilities with a thorough appreciation for abstraction. My paintings are compositions of internal places not visited on foot. When working with atmosphere and diffused light, I’m able to emphasize my interest in the plasticity of paint, rather than the physics of light. These paintings are a continuation of my exploration into the language of atmosphere and the ethereal world of light and place. The use of tonal gradation and converging lines which dissolve into accumulating layers of mist are signature elements in my works.”
